A buddy of mine gave me a sporty little steering wheel, basically a Monte Carlo knock off, EXCEPT it only has 5 retaining screws, not 6.
What adapter do I need? |

Definatley not Momo 6 bolt, Not fittipalidi (personal wheels) 6 bolt, Sparco 6 bolt.
You might be able to use a Momo hub and drill and tap your new holes. |

Grant wheels have the 5 hole pattern as I remember. I think the adapter is NLA from them but you might find a used one on ebay or post a wtb ad in the classifieds.

if brians doesnt pan out.. you can usually drill and tap a momo 6 hole for a grant 5 hole..... (assuming bolt circle is close)
renegade also makes a 5 hole adapter |
